Frequently asked questions (FAQs) about the NCVT CBT Exam:
- Q: What is the passing marks in ITI NCVT CBT exam? A: The passing marks for ITI NCVT CBT exam vary depending on the trade and course, but generally, Minimum pass marks for theoretical paper-33%,for Practical and Formative assessment - 60%
- Q: What are the passing marks for ITI CBT/Practical exams and the exam pattern subject-wise?
- Trade Theory:
- Total No. of Questions: 50 (38 Trade Theory questions, 6 Workshop Calculation & Science questions, 6 Engineering Drawing questions)
- Maximum Marks: 100
- Passing Marks: 33
- Employability Skill:
- Total No. of Questions: 25
- Maximum Marks: 50
- Passing Marks: 17
- Trade Practical:
- Total Marks: 250
- Passing Marks: 150
- Formative Assessment:
- Total Marks: 200
- Passing Marks: 120
- Q: What is CBT in ITI? A: CBT in ITI refers to Computer Based Test, which is a mode of examination conducted online using a computer or laptop.
- Q: What happens if I fail in ITI exam? A: If you fail in ITI exam, you can appear for the supplementary exam, which is conducted after a few months. If you fail in the supplementary exam, you will have to reappear for the regular exam in the next academic year.
